Why CBD works as a better anxiolytic than other anti-anxiety medicine
Anxiety and related disorders can be treated by targeting the serotonin system in the human body. Various preclinical studies have shed light in the right direction.
While many options are available already in the market, still, medical cannabis is rising in popularity as a medicinal alternative for managing those emergency panic attacks.
CBD works similarly to serotonin reuptake inhibitors or SSRIs like Zoloft and Prozac. They stop reabsorption of serotonin in the brain, making sure there is more present in the synaptic space.
It has also been revealed that CBD increases 5-HT1A transmission and affects serotonin faster than SSRIs. This is probably one reason why CBD based products have the potential to overcome the limitations of currently prescribed anti-anxiety medication therapies.
